Virtual Server, igen...

Är Ni nybörjare i UNIX/Linux? Detta forum avhandla allmäna UNIX frågor.
Post Reply
potatis
Posts: 20
Joined: 24 August 2005, 23:04

Virtual Server, igen...

Post by potatis » 10 February 2006, 13:47

Installerade om min server nu under natten, men får inte Virtual Server att fungera... utan alla domäner kommer till samma sida...

från min hpptd.conf fil

Code: Select all


NameVirtualHost *

<VirtualHost *>
ServerName htstat.homelinux.com
DocumentRoot /home/htstat/public_html
</VirtualHost>

<VirtualHost *>
ServerName blogg.homelinux.com
DocumentRoot /var/www/
</VirtualHost> 
Jag tycker att detta är helt korrekt, men oavsett vilken sida jag försköker ansluta till hamnar jag alltid på den första hosten. Någon som har tips eller förslag på lösning?

User avatar
Bar-Code
Posts: 838
Joined: 22 November 2002, 07:21

Post by Bar-Code » 10 February 2006, 14:36

Directory

Code: Select all

<VirtualHost *>
        ServerName subdomain.domain.com
        DocumentRoot /var/www/subdomain.domain.com
        <Directory /var/www/subdomain.domain.com>
                Options Indexes Includes MultiViews
                AllowOverride All
                Order allow,deny
                Allow from all
        </Directory>
</VirtualHost>
There are 10 kinds of people; those who understand binary, and those who don't.

potatis
Posts: 20
Joined: 24 August 2005, 23:04

Post by potatis » 10 February 2006, 14:41

Kannon!

det funka.

User avatar
Emil.s
Posts: 4366
Joined: 24 May 2005, 22:22
Location: Hedemora/Dalarna
Contact:

Post by Emil.s » 10 February 2006, 17:43

En fråga:
Vad är "VirtualHost" egentligen?
Innan ni postar: Läs FAQen
När ni postar:
Posta i Rätt forum! Och skriv/formulera dig rätt

Sourcer
Posts: 1183
Joined: 15 October 2005, 21:37

Post by Sourcer » 10 February 2006, 22:48

Det är en funktion som gör att du slipper ha en server för varje hemsida. Webservern känner av vilken adress någon surfar till och visar då den hemsidan. För att det ska fungera för t.ex. hemsidan http://www.demo1.se och http://www.demo2.se så måste bägge domännamnen peka på samma IP adress i DNS (samma dator om den har flera IP adresser).
Last edited by Sourcer on 10 February 2006, 23:24, edited 1 time in total.

mikma
Posts: 3349
Joined: 10 July 2003, 21:19

Post by mikma » 10 February 2006, 23:04

Man kan väl ha virtual host med olika ip-adresser också?

Sourcer
Posts: 1183
Joined: 15 October 2005, 21:37

Post by Sourcer » 10 February 2006, 23:14

Om webservern har flera IP adresser, svar ja.

Exempel:

Code: Select all

Listen 80

# This is the "main" server running on 172.20.30.40
ServerName server.domain.com
DocumentRoot /www/mainserver

# This is the other address
NameVirtualHost 172.20.30.50

<VirtualHost 172.20.30.50>

DocumentRoot /www/example1
ServerName www.example1.com

# Other directives here ...


</VirtualHost>

<VirtualHost 172.20.30.50>

DocumentRoot /www/example2
ServerName www.example2.org

# Other directives here ...


</VirtualHost> 
Allt det här står i manualen, så det är bara att läsa.

Post Reply